日期:2014-05-16  浏览次数:21047 次

linux上传、下载、基本命令

其实linux使用起来很简单,要亲自动手才能体会到。
下面我们就新手测试一下。
命令如下:
1.linux下创建文件夹      mkdir book (mkdir创建文件夹命令,book文件夹)
2.linux下删除文件夹      rmdir book (rmdir删除文件夹命令,book文件夹)
3.linux下创建文档        touch a.text(touch 创建命令 a.text文本文件)
4.linux下编译文档        vim a.text  ( vim编辑   a.text文档)
5.linux下退出编辑文档   :后   使用wq  (保存退出命令) esc 改变状态   h查看帮助
6.linux下不保存退出编辑文档 q!
7.linux下查看文档         cat a.text (cat查看文档命令 a.text文档)
8.linux下查看文档         more a.text (按照行,一行一行的看)
8.linux下删除文档         rm -rf 文档(rm 删除命令  -rf参数   文件名)
9.linux下先提示在删除文档  rm -i 文档名(rm 删除 -i参数 文档名)
10.linux下将文档拷贝到另一个文件夹  a文件夹 -b文件夹 
 命令 #ls  cd a  
     # cp a.text /b/

说明:ls 显示    cd切换到指定目录 a 目录,cp 拷贝命令  a.text文档 /绝对路径/b文件夹/下



11.linux修改文档名字  mv a.text  b.text(mv修改命令 a.text文档,b.text文档)
12.linux修改文件名字  mv a  b(mv修改命令 a文件,b文件)
13.linux显示磁盘信息  df  (df显示磁盘信息)
14.linux剪切文件     mv 文件名  文件夹/
15.linux关闭系统   init 0
16.linux重启系统   init 6 ,reboot(也可以重启系统)
17.linux压缩zip文件 zip wangjinlong.zip wangjilong (wangjinlong.zip压缩后的文件名 wangjinlong指 压缩文件)
18.删除 压缩文件 rm -r 文件名(无论是否有数据均可删除) r是删除提示 -f强制删除
19.linux压缩war文件 
因为种种原因公司需要把java程序达成war包。起先用zip命令打包,起先可以用,后来却无法使用。今天找到一个更好的办法。用jar命令,前提是要安装dk。

把当前目录下的所有文件打包成game.war
jar -cvfM0 game.war ./

-c   创建war包
-v   显示过程信息
-f    
-M
-0   这个是阿拉伯数字,只打包不压缩的意思


解压game.war

jar -xvf game.war

解压到当前目录




rar和zip文件的压缩和解压缩
1.zip

Linux下自带了一个unzip的程序可以解压缩文件,解压命令是:

unzip filename.zip



同样也提供了一个zip程序压缩zip文件,命令是

zip filename.zip files

会将files压缩到filename.zip


2.rar

由于rar是收费软件,所以linux并没有自带这个加压和解压的软件。你可以到rar官方网站http://www.rarsoft.com 下去下载试用版本

安装好后,可用命令

unrar e filename.rar 解压文件

rar a files filename 会将files压缩成filename.rar。这里注意rar会自动在你的文件后面加上后缀.rar。


注:要解压缩 zip 文件,使用 unzip archive.zip 命令。如果想指定将档案扩展到哪个目录中,可以使用 -d 选项(例如, unzip file.zip -d /home/james/zips 将 file.zip 的内容抽取到 /home/james/zips 目录中)。


unzip /home/divivit/public_html/sihaimc.cn/games.zip -d /home/divivit/public_html/sihaimc.cn/

unzip /home/divivit/public_html/feelife.org/elgg/mod/group_custom_layout.zip -d /home/divivit/public_html/feelife.org/elgg/mod/


参考:http://www.ibm.com/developerworks/cn/linux/l-tip-prompt/tip07/index.html


功能说明:解压缩zip文件

语  法:unzip [-cflptuvz][-agCjLMnoqsVX][-P <密码>][.zip文件][文件][-d <目录>][-x <文件>] 或 unzip [-Z]

补充说明:unzip为.zip压缩文件的解压缩程序。

参  数:
-c 将解压缩的结果显示到屏幕上,并对字符做适当的转换。
-f 更新现有的文件。
-l 显示压缩文件内所包含的文件。
-p 与-c参数类似,会将解压缩的结果显示到屏幕上,但不会执行任何的转换。
-t 检查压缩文件是否正确。
-u 与-f参数类似,但是除了更新现有的文件外,也会将压缩文件中的其他文件解压缩到目录中。
-v 执行是时显示详细的信息。
-z 仅显示压缩文件的备注文字。
-a 对文本文件进行必要的字符转换。
-b 不要对文本文件进行字符转换。
-C 压缩文件中的文件名称区分大小写。
-j 不处理压缩文件中原有的目录路径。
-L 将压缩文件中的全部文件名改为小写。
-M 将输出结果送到more程序处理。
-n 解压缩时不要覆盖原有的文件。
-o 不必先询问用户,unzip执行后覆盖原有文件。
-P<密码> 使用zip的密码选项。
-q 执行时不显示任何信息。
-s 将文件名中的空白字符转换为底线字符。
-V 保留VMS的文件版本信息。
-X 解压缩时同时回存文件原来的UID/GID。
[.zip文件] 指定.zip压缩文件。
[文件] 指定要处理.zip压缩文件中的哪些文件。
-d<目录> 指定文件解压缩后所要存储的目录。
-x<文件> 指定不要处理.zip压缩文件中的哪些文件。
-Z unzip -Z等于执行zipinfo指令



启动应用程序
先初始化,命令是:mysql_install_db 
然后启动服务,命令是:service mysqld start 
关闭程序服务,命令是:service mysqld stop



现在给大家介绍一个更好使用的工具 SecureCRT使用他直接可以上传和下载文件啦!

sz + 文件名   如果windows机器下有建立自己的用户  就到自己用户下载中查看  例如:我的机器 一个账户是王金龙   一个是admin  我下载 后到王金龙 包中--下载包中查看

上传文件 rz 选择上传的文件   同理。。。。上传文件要根据你在的当前目录,所以直接用命令ls 就可以查看上传的文件了。